    Which Lawn Is Best for Kids and Pets in Perth?

    Choosing the right lawn for a family home in Perth means more than just choosing the lawn that looks best. The level of use the lawn receives from kids and pets running and playing will influence which variety will perform best.

    What Makes a Lawn Safe for Kids and Pets?

    A lawn that provides a safe playing surface is very important for a family home. Factors that contribute to a lawn’s safety include the surface and how it will feel, hold up, and grow with daily use.

    A lawn that works well for families should:

    • Feel soft to reduce impact during play
    • Maintain a dense surface to avoid exposed soil
    • Recover quickly from wear and minor damage
    • Stay relatively even instead of becoming patchy

    When thinking about which lawn is best for your kids and pets, the focus is on consistency. A lawn that can withstand the level of wear and tear and maintain even coverage tends to be far safer than one that thins out with use.

    What Grass Is Best for Dogs & Kids in Perth Backyards?

    When considering which grasses are best for dogs, durability and recovery matter most.

    In Perth conditions, the buffalo varieties are commonly used for family lawns as they offer a balance between comfort and performance. They provide a softer surface while still handling wear well.

    Kikuyu is another popular option, particularly for high-use areas. It grows quickly and recovers well, so it copes better with active backyards. Kikuyu requires more frequent mowing and doesn’t perform as well in shaded areas.

    Couch grass can also be considered. It typically needs consistent maintenance and doesn’t perform well in shaded areas.

    Which are the Popular Pet-Friendly Turf Options in Perth? 

    Here’s a simple comparison of commonly used pet-friendly turf options:

    Turf Type Softness Durability Maintenance Suitability for Pets & Kids
    Buffalo Softest Moderate to High Low Suitable, softer and strong all-round option
    Kikuyu Soft Very High Moderate to High Suitable, copes best with very active dogs
    Couch Soft High High Suitable

    If you’re planning a pet-friendly lawn, buffalo tends to offer a more balanced outcome across comfort, durability, and ease of upkeep.

    How Lawn Choice Affects Backyard Safety?

    All varieties of lawn have the ability to be a safe, soft, dense lawn with the right maintenance schedule. 

    The type of lawn you choose must be able to cope with the level of wear and tear that will occur in your backyard. This will directly affect how safe and functional your backyard feels over time.

    Lawns with a lower wear tolerance tend to develop bare patches, turning into mud or hard ground. This is where safety starts to decrease, especially in areas that see repeated use.

    Recovery of the lawn also plays a role. Lawns that repair themselves faster tend to stay more consistent, while slower-recovering turf can become uneven over time.

    The right lawn choice means a surface that stays stable, comfortable, and consistent every day with how you use it.
